credits

released September 9, 2018

Written, Performed, and Produced by The Kelseys
Mixed & Mastered by Tyler Floyd at Summit House Studios
Drum Tracking by Ryan Cox
Trumpet on Half Right by Cameron McClelland
Cover Art by Megan Lewis-Smith
